Handover: Exportron retry queue

Hi Mira — handing over the failed-export retries. Exports that hit a timeout land in the retry queue and get three attempts with backoff; after that they're parked and need a manual requeue from the admin panel. Watch for customers reporting duplicates — that usually means a double requeue. The current retry settings are as follows.

settings of bajog-fawig:
oliael:
  log_level: warn
  metrics_host: metrics.oliael.zemvarsys.internal
  pin: 0267
  pool_size: 32

**Leadership Review Briefing — Pilot Update**

Board summary: the Calverno shelf-analytics pilot with the Marrow & Finch retail chain is eight weeks in. Twelve stores live. Stock-out detection accuracy at 91%, above the 85% target. Chain-side sponsor satisfied; two store managers flagged training gaps, now addressed. Cost per store tracking 6% under estimate. Decision needed next month on expansion to their northern region. Recommendation: proceed, subject to contract terms. Confidential planning detail is set out below.

internal memo for kawip-hadug: Headcount on the Wenwyn team goes from 7 to 140 by the end of January. Gross margin on Wenwyn came in at 20 percent against a plan of 15 percent.

## Rotating secrets with Twistkey

Welcome aboard! To rotate a secret, run Twistkey with the service name and it handles generation, push, and old-key revocation after a 24-hour overlap. Don't rotate anything tagged `legacy` without pinging the Ferngate team first. When you're done, verify the rotation against the build shown below.

pipeline stamp: htk9_ce63042d9